Trainer applicants have rated the interview process at JPMorganChase with 2.7 out of 5 (where 5 is the highest level of difficulty) and assessed their interview experience as 100% positive. To compare, the company-average is 62.7% positive. This is according to Glassdoor user ratings.
Candidates applying for Trainer roles take an average of 79 days to get hired, when considering 3 user submitted interviews for this role. To compare, the hiring process at JPMorganChase overall takes an average of 27 days.
Common stages of the interview process at JPMorganChase as a Trainer according to 3 Glassdoor interviews include:
Phone interview: 25%
Drug test: 13%
One on one interview: 13%
Presentation: 13%
Group panel interview: 13%
Background check: 13%
Skills test: 13%
